# Quick note for the weekly sync: the Brindlewick client now uses a shared
# connection pool capped at 20. We kept burning through Postgres slots when
# every worker on Loomcart spun up its own pool, so don't override pool_size
# unless you ping the platform crew first. The pool auth service expects the
# key below.

service key, tadup-tahog: zpat7_wB1tnEL

Minutes — Management Meeting

Prepared for the incoming director. Topic: possible acquisition of Greyfen Analytics. Due diligence 70% complete. Valuation gap remains; Greyfen seeks a premium. Integration risks flagged by Ops. Decision deferred to next month. Talla Nyberg leads negotiations. Our walk-away position is stated below.

board note of fawig-kagup: Only 48 of the 435 pilot accounts renewed Rusion, so a churn review is set for September 12. Fenwynox Logistics is in early talks to buy Sorielek Systems for about $117.8 million.

## Ownership: Snapshot Testing

All snapshot tests for Lanternleaf UI components live under `tests/snapshots/`. Baseline updates require a reviewed pull request; never regenerate baselines on a release branch. Rendering differences caused by upstream theme changes must be triaged before tagging a release candidate. For approval of baseline changes, or any disputed diff during a release cut, defer to the accountable owner.

named custodian: Brivan Eliath Quenox Frador

Fan-out backpressure for the Quillet notifier: when the queue depth crosses the soft limit, the dispatcher sheds low-priority pushes and batches the rest at 500ms intervals. Reviewer should confirm the shed counter is exported and that retries respect the jitter window. Once merged, the release artifact gets re-signed by the pipeline, which expects the deploy key shown below.

deploy key for bawep-yawif: bky6_GQhaSt